Q4: For the linear system 

2x -  y + 3z =  5
3x +  y + 4z =  2
-x + 5y – 2z = -2 

(i)Write the system in matrix from AX = B 

    A      X =   B 

[ 2 -1  3][x]   [ 5]
[ 3  1  4][y] = [ 2]
[-1  5 –2][z]   [-2] 


(ii)Obtain the determinant and inverse of A. 
 
I will assume you know how to get the value 
of a 3×3 determinant, and how to find the
minors and the transpose. If you don't post 
again asking how.

         | 2 -1  3|           
det(A) = | 3  1  4| = 2           
         |-1  5 –2|           

First find the cofactor matrix.
Replace each element of A by the value of
its minor 2×2 determinant with the sign
left as it is or changed according to the
sign scheme:

       |+ - +|
       |- + -|
       |+ - +|

                  [-22   2   16]
cofactor matrix = [ 13  -1   -9]
                  [ -7   1    5]

Take the transpose of the cofactor matrix,
which is called the adjoint matrix:

                  [-22  13   -7]
adjoint matrix =  [  2  -1    1]
                  [ 16  -9    5]

Divide every member of the adjoint matrix
by the determinant of A.  This is the
inverse of A, written A-1:

                       [-11 13/2  -7/2]
Inverse matrix = A-1 = [  1 -1/2   1/2]
                       {  8 -9/2   5/2]   



(iii)Solve the system.

Go back to the system in matrix form AX = B

                      A     X  =   B

                 [ 2 -1  3][x]   [ 5]
                 [ 3  1  4][y] = [ 2]
                 [-1  5 –2][z]   [-2] 

Left-multiply both sides by the inverse matrix and
get the form A-1AX = A-1Bx

      A-1             A     X  =          A-1      X  
    
[-11 13/2  -7/2] [ 2 -1  3][x]   [-11 13/2  -7/2][ 5]
[  1 -1/2   1/2] [ 3  1  4][y] = [  1 -1/2   1/2][ 2]
{  8 -9/2   5/2] [-1  5 –2][z]   {  8 -9/2   5/2][-2]

Do the matrix multiplication A-1AX = A-1B becomes
                                IX = A-1B which becomes:
                                 X = A-1B
                                 like this:

                       I     X  = A-1B  

                   [1  0  0][x]   [-35]
                   [0  1  0][y] = [  3]
                   [0  0  1][z]   [ 26]

                     
                             X  = A-1B  

                            [x]   [-35]
                            [y] = [  3]
                            [z]   [ 26]
